18.1 场景复现 我们现在模拟一下现场,首先我会新建一个分支,然后修改一些内容,然后提交到版本控制器中,最后再将此分支删除,模拟出分支被删除的情况。 首先,我们查看当前版本库控制器中有哪些分支,参考命令如下: git …
标签:git
git reflog 恢复已删除分支
语法: git reflog –date=[iso | local | relative] | grep [-w 全词匹配] <branchname> iso:格式化后的时间时间 local:实际…
git 恢复本地误删的文件或文件夹
如果不小心误删了某个文件或文件夹时,可以通过git操作来恢复。 1.git status 查看本地改动的状态,如下图所示,误删了文件夹”approving” (文件”informati…
如何使用git合并多次提交
在为代码添加一个新功能的时候你会怎么做?(从git的操作顺序来说) 如果是我的话,顺序如下: 先是使用git checkout -b ,来新建一个新的分支,然后开始按照自己提前思考好的逻辑加入新代码 写好这个功能并调试好…
git 删除文件后如何恢复此文件
我今拉代码的代码,不小心把一个文件给删了。很后悔,关键我删完了还push了。 git:(dev) git rm HomeController.php rm ‘app/Http/Controlle…
Git学习总结(21)——Git 提交规范总结
一、为什么需要规范? 无规矩不成方圆,编程也一样。 如果你有一个项目,从始至终都是自己写,那么你想怎么写都可以,没有人可以干预你。可是如果在团队协作中,大家都张扬个性,那么代码将会是一团糟,好好的项目就被糟践了。不管是开…
Git查看及修改用户名和邮箱
1、查看命令 git config --local --list 2、查看当前用户名 git config user.name 3、查看邮箱 git config user.email 4、修改用户名 git confi…
配置Beyond Compare 4作为git mergetool来解决git merge命令导致的文件冲突
文章目录 前言 解决方案 前提 配置 Beyond Compare 文件冲突及处理 产生冲突 解决冲突 工具配置的参数含义 git config git mergetool 思考 总结 前言 使用 git merge 命…
git 回退到某次提交
回退命令: $ git reset –hard HEAD^ 回退到上个版本 $ git reset –hard HEAD~3 回退到前3次提交之前,以此类推,回退到n次提交之前 $ git res…
git 多次merge并commit后如何撤销merge过的分支
背景: 两个需求的分支,DEV_A和DEV_B,计划B是要在A之后上线的,两个分支开发的过程中,B分支多次merge A分支的代码,并同时commit代码到A分支。最后由于项目变动,需要B分支线上线,就出现了怎么从B分支…
实战:git中正确删除文件的方法-2021.12.07
目录 文章目录 目录 实验环境 实验软件 1、实验目的 2、配置方法 3、命令总结 1.正确删除文件的方法:`rm命令` 2.借Github的merge button,讲解GitHub的三种merge方式 关于我 最后 …
Jupyter notebook文件默认存储路径以及更改方法
1.安装Anaconda后,新建文件的默认存储路径一般在C系统盘,那么路径是什么呢? 首先先打开jupyter Notebook ,再点击new,再点击Python3. 接着输入以下命令: import os print…